The child custody battle between music superstar Usher and his ex-wife Tameka Foster over their two children is getting nasty. Usher claims that Tameka threatened to kill him, but Foster claims that while she did say “I’ll f*ck you up,” it wasn’t a threat to kill.

The custody cased went to a Georgia courtroom last week, where Usher’s legal team questioned Foster about her verbal threats against the singer, as seen in the video below. Allegedly, Usher claims that Foster said, “I will kill you both” referring to him and his current girlfriend. Foster responds “I did probably, out of anger, say ‘I will f**k you up’ and it’s not acceptable.”

The harsh statement, Foster says, comes from the anger and embarrassment she feels from Usher and his new girlfriend coming in and out of her town, which she says is a close-knit community.

The trial resumes sometime this week.
